    Hi sandrayannetta,
    If you can see the jammed paper at the front tray, or you cannot see the paper either at the paper output slot or at the front tray, remove the paper from the transport unit.  Remove the paper following the procedure below:
    Turn the machine off, then unplug the power cord.
    Stand the machine with the right side facing down.
    If you can see the jammed paper at the front tray, stand the machine with the front tray open.
    Important:
    When you stand the machine, confirm that the document cover is closed.
    When you stand the machine, hold it securely and be careful not to hit it on a hard object.
    Push the open lever to open the transport unit.
    (A) Open lever
    When you open the transport unit, support it with your hand so that it does not fall down.
    Pull out the jammed paper slowly.
    Note:
    If the paper is rolled up and it is difficult to remove, grasp the edges of the paper, then remove the jammed paper.
    If you cannot remove the jammed paper from the transport unit, close the transport unit, stand the machine upright, then open the paper output cover to remove the paper.
    . Close the transport unit.
    Note:After you close the transport unit, do not keep the machine standing upright.
    Plug the machine back in and turn the machine back on.
    Reload the paper.  All print jobs in the queue are canceled. Reprint if necessary.

  • How can I print just a part of the page and not the full page with Adobe Reader v 10.1.2?

    how can I print just a part of the page and not the full page with Adobe Reader v 10.1.2? I need to print a engineering print with lot of information but information is too small in letter size and I don't have a plotter.

    Two ways to print a portion of a page: zooming or using the Snapshot Tool.
    ZOOMING:
    Zoom into the area you want to print.
    Click the Print icon.
    Under "Pages to Print", make sure "Current view" is selected under "More options" (you may need to click "More options" to open it).
    If you aren't satisfied with the preview, try clicking "Fit" under the Size button.
    SNAPSHOT
    Choose Edit > Take A Snapshot.
    Drag a rectangle around the area you want to print. 
    Click the Print icon.
    Under "Pages to Print", make sure that "Selected Graphic" is selected under "More options".
    To enlarge the snapshot to fit the sheet of paper, choose "Fit" under the Size button.

  • I started to learn HTML, and I'm using text edit and everything is going fine, when I save the file with a .html extension and open it with safari I only view the code and not the webpage that was supposed to be created.

    I started to learn HTML, and I'm using text edit and everything is going fine, when I save the file with a .html extension and open it with safari I only view the code and not the webpage that was supposed to be created.

    That is because you don't have a web server configured and running to serve the html page. In order to see the page in a browser you need to access it using a url similar to http://localhost/~yourUserName if you are serving the page from your user account.
    Prior to Mountain Lion you could go into web sharing and turn on the web server. With Mountain Lion there is no option, other than using terminal, to turn on the web server. The web sharing menu item has been removed in Mountain Lion. Apache is still on your computer but it will take a little searching these forums or the Internet to find how to turn it on.
    If you want a graphic user interface to turn on/off the Apache server you could download and install a server application like xampp, http://www.apachefriends.org/en/xampp.html. I use this and it works well.

    What's the plist file?
    For new users: Every application on your Mac has an accompanying plist file. It records certain User choices. For instance, in your favourite Word Processor it remembers your choice of Default Font, on your Web Browser is remembers things like your choice of Home Page. It even recalls what windows you had open last if your app allows you to pick up from where you left off last. The iPhoto plist file remembers things like the location of the Library, your choice of background colour, whether you are running a Referenced or Managed Library, what preferences you have for autosplitting events and so on. Trashing the plist file forces the app to generate a new one on the next launch, and this restores things to the Factory Defaults. Hence, if you've changed any of these things you'll need to reset them. If you haven't, then no bother. Trashing the plist file is Mac troubleshooting 101.
